HOUSTON, Oct. 9,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Colossus Media LLC ("Colossus SSP"), the inclusive supply-side advertising platform, today announced its participation in the Media Rating Council's (MRC) newly formed Digital Ad Auction Standards Working Group. This initiative aims to bring greater transparency, standardization, and predictability to auction dynamics in the digital advertising marketplace.

The digital advertising ecosystem has long grappled with challenges surrounding auction transparency and consistency. The Auction Standards Working Group, spearheaded by MRC in coordination with member organizations, including 4A's and others to establish insights, metrics, and standards to enable auction users to transact with complete knowledge and confidence. By fostering an environment of open dialogue and shared expertise, the working group seeks to develop comprehensive standards that will empower advertisers, publishers, and technology providers alike.

The Auction Standards Working Group's objective is crucial to the industry's evolution, focusing on key areas such as:

  1. Enhancing transparency in digital ad auction rules and practices

  2. Standardizing reporting of auction variables and outcomes

  3. Developing a framework for independent audit and verification
